Senior Finance Business Partner - Unicorn FinTech
London (+WFH capacity)
£70k - £80k + Shares
This celebrated FinTech group has experienced 5 years of parabolic growth and is actively seeking to identify a high-calibre commercial finance professional to business partner the group's core sales, marketing and customer functions.
Role Overview:
Act as a primary business partner to the sales, marketing and customer functions, integrating and aligning all commercial and cost planning activities into the group structure.
Full ownership for defining and preparing strategic plans, project roadmap, stakeholder mapping and engagement, budgeting and forecasting, leading and planning all workshop sessions.
Develop clever data tools and financial models to measure project success and provide management information to summarise achievements.
Work with 'Tech' to review new initiatives, stress-testing their commercial viability.
Skills/Credentials Desired:
Qualified Accountant (ACA/CIMA/ACA)
Immaculate academic record
Experience on working in fast-paced, analytical environment
Anaplan, Power PI or other intelligence tools would be beneficial
